Output 877771816c91cd57792c2fe33e6207b8210db7592835ca5f47fcc17a4a59c117:0

value
353585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98873ec560b3833611499baa03e985ae58e82341 OP_EQUAL
address
3FbWehjgw8jAeq3PVcaDrGqe3ebr859epb
transaction
877771816c91cd57792c2fe33e6207b8210db7592835ca5f47fcc17a4a59c117
spent
true